This was a very common scene where we were hunting. And Drake turned out to REALLY love the smell of turkeys. One of the first things he started trailing with a vengeance was a flock of turkeys. We didn’t know what he was trailing but he was on fire. He moved through that grass with a purpose. He hit that barbed wire fence and was trembling just aching with the desire to get through that fence. (Drake had learned once about barbed wire fences and was very good about waiting when he needed to get through the fence for him to be released through the fence) Steve didn’t see any birds go out of the fence but when it was clear that Drake really wanted to go, he lifted the barbed wire and off he went….a few seconds later there was a monstrous flush of turkeys. He was so pleased with himself and we were so pleased to see him have lots of interest in birds he’d never had any exposure to.
